Nigeria has twenty two airports with paved runways.Nine are International airports and thirteen are domestic airports.There are also twenty one airstrips scattered around the country.The airports in Nigeria are;

 International Airports:'(9)'
  • Murtala Mohammed International airport, Lagos
  • Nnamdi Azikiwe International airport, Abuja
  • Mallam Aminu Kano International airport, Kano
  • Port Harcourt International airport, Port Harcourt
  • Sadiq Abubakar International airport, Sokoto
  • Maiduguri International airport, Maiduguri
  • Kaduna International airport, Kaduna
  • Ilorin International airport, Ilorin
  • Magaret Ekpo International airport, Calabar
